Žinios Discovery
/ Knowledge Discovery >> Žinios Discovery >> Technika >> kompiuteris >> kompiuterių programinė įranga >>

Kaip C programavimo Works

andinės eilutės argumentas keisti versiją kaip šią komandą: Rīga,

gcc -std c99 -o myprogram.exe myprogram.c

Aukščiau komandą, " gcc " yra skambutis paleisti sudarytojas ir visa kita yra komandų eilutės parinktis, arba argumentas. &Quot; -std " galimybė buvo įtraukta po " c99 " pasakyti kompiliatorių naudoti C99 standartinę versiją C per savo kompiliuojant. &Quot; -o " galimybė buvo pridėta po saldumo "myprogram.exe " prašyti, kad vykdomąjį, kompiliatorių išvesties failą, kuris bus pavadintas myprogram.exe. Be " -o " vykdomąjį automatiškai pavadintas a.out vietoj. Galutinis argumentas " myprogram.c " rodo, kad teksto failas su C kodas turi būti rengiami. Trumpai tariant, ši komanda sako, " Ei, gcc, kaupia myprogram.c naudojant C99 C programavimo standartą ir daro rezultatus į failą, pavadintą myprogram.exe. &Quot; Naršykite žiniatinklį už pilną funkcijų sąrašą galite naudoti su konkrečiu jūsų kompiliatorius, ar tai gcc ar kažkas.

įdiegta jūsų sudarytojas, esate pasirengę programuoti C Pradėkime atsižvelgiant išvaizdą ne pagrindinio struktūros Vienas iš paprasčiausių C programos galėtumėte rašyti.
Paprasčiausias C programa

Pažvelkime paprasta C programą ir naudoti ją tiek suprasti C pagrindai ir C rengimo procesą , Jei turite savo kompiuterį su C kompiliatorius įdiegta kaip aprašyta anksčiau, galite sukurti tekstinį failą pavadinimu sample.c ir naudoti jį sekti kartu, o mes žingsnis per šiame pavyzdyje. Atkreipkite dėmesį, kad jei paliksite off .c į failo pavadinimą, arba jei jūsų redaktorius prideda Txt vardą, jūs tikriausiai kažkiek klaidų rūšiuoti, kai jūs surinkti jį

Štai mūsų pavyzdys programą.:

/* Mėginio programa * /

# include < stdio.h >

int main ()

{

printf (" Tai išėjimas iš mano pirmosios programos \\ n "!);

grąža 0;

}

Kai sudaromi ir vykdomi, ši programa nurodo kompiuterio atsispausdinti linijos " Tai išėjimas iš mano pirmosios programos "!; ir tada sustoti. Jūs negalite gauti daug paprasčiau nei tai! Dabar galime pažvelgti, ką kiekviena eilutė daro.

1 eilutė - tai vienas iš būdų rašyti komentarus C, tarp /* ir * /iš vienos arba daugiau ūdų

2 eilutė - #include komanda pasakoja kompiliatorių ieškoti kitų šaltinių esama C kodas, ypač bibliotekų, kurios yra failai, kuriuos apima bendras daugkartinio naudojimo instru